Eligibility Criteria for ISB Job Vacancies
Most candidates fail because they ignore fine details.
Here is how eligibility usually works:
Educational Requirements
- Intermediate: Clerical support roles
- Bachelor’s Degree: Assistant, Inspector, Officer roles
- Master’s Degree: Policy, research, senior officer roles
HEC-recognised degrees are mandatory. Equivalence certificates are strictly verified.
Age Criteria
- General age bracket: 18–30 years
- Relaxation: 5 years (federal rule)
- Additional relaxations: As per special categories
Candidates often miscalculate age on closing date. This leads to automatic rejection.
Experience (For Senior Posts)
- 2–5 years relevant experience
- Experience certificates must include clear job descriptions
- Government experience carries weight
Salary Package & Pay Scale Structure (2026)
Understanding the salary package is critical before you apply online.
Estimated Federal Pay Structure
| BPS | Basic Pay Approx. (PKR) | Estimated Gross Monthly (PKR) |
|---|---|---|
| BPS-11 | 37,000 | 55,000–65,000 |
| BPS-14 | 42,000 | 65,000–75,000 |
| BPS-16 | 48,000 | 75,000–90,000 |
| BPS-17 | 65,000 | 100,000–130,000 |
| BPS-18 | 82,000 | 140,000+ |
Gross salary includes:
- House Rent Allowance
- Medical Allowance
- Conveyance
- Adhoc Relief 2026
- Utility allowance (in some departments)
Additionally, Islamabad postings often include higher rental benefits due to cost of living.

Real Recruitment Journey for ISB Job Vacancies
Many applicants search: How to apply for isb job vacancies in Pakistan?
Here is the practical 8-step journey.
Step 1: Identify Official Advertisement
Check:
- FPSC official website
- Ministry websites
- Leading newspapers
Avoid social media-only announcements.
Step 2: Read Eligibility Criteria Carefully
Match:
- Qualification
- Age
- Experience
- Domicile (if required)
Step 3: Create Online Profile
Register at:
- FPSC portal
- Department official website
Keep CNIC and email active.
Step 4: Complete Digital Form
Enter:
- Academic details
- Experience records
- Contact information
Even minor spelling mistakes cause issues later.
Step 5: Upload Documents
Prepare scanned copies of:
- CNIC
- Academic certificates
- Domicile
- Experience letters
Ensure clarity and legibility.
Step 6: Pay Application Fee
Payment methods usually include:
- National Bank branch
- ATM transfer
- Online banking
Keep receipt safely.
Step 7: Download Admission Certificate
Available before written test.
Check test centre carefully.
Step 8: Written Test & Interview
Federal tests include:
- General Knowledge
- Pakistan Affairs
- Current Affairs
- English comprehension
- Subject-specific MCQs
Interview panels focus on confidence, knowledge, and communication clarity.

Career Growth & Promotion in Federal Service
Federal careers offer structured promotion:
- BPS-16 to BPS-17 via departmental exams
- BPS-17 to BPS-18 through promotion boards
- Senior management roles after 10–15 years
Additionally, officers may receive:
- Foreign training
- Inter-ministerial transfers
- Deputation opportunities
Long-term benefits include pension, gratuity, and medical coverage.
